ByAUJay
Sidechains vs Rollups: Cost, Security, and UX
An in-depth look designed for both startups and big enterprises that are exploring scalable blockchain solutions--focusing on cost savings, security pros and cons, and the overall user experience.
Introduction
Blockchain scalability is still a big hurdle for both big companies and startups trying to achieve that sweet spot of high throughput, low latency, and affordable solutions. Two of the most exciting options out there are sidechains and rollups. Each comes with its own set of perks and downsides.
This guide provides a thorough look at how to help decision-makers find the best approach tailored to their project's needs. We’ll dive into important aspects like cost, security models, and user experience (UX).
Understanding Sidechains and Rollups
What Are Sidechains?
Sidechains are like their own little blockchains that connect to a main chain (think Ethereum) through two-way bridges. They run independently, which means they have their own consensus mechanisms, validators, and security measures.
Key Features:
- Different consensus mechanisms (like Proof-of-Authority or using delegated validators)
- Governance and features that you can customize
- Transferring assets using pegged tokens (for example, linking ETH on Ethereum to a sidechain token)
Use Cases:
- Tailored blockchain features (like privacy options or unique tokenomics)
- Applications that need to handle a lot of transactions (think gaming or DeFi protocols with a ton of activity)
What Are Rollups?
Rollups are these cool Layer 2 (L2) solutions that handle transactions off the main blockchain. They do all the heavy lifting off-chain and then send compressed data back to the main chain to keep everything secure.
Types of Rollups:
- Optimistic Rollups: These guys take a leap of faith and assume that transactions are good to go. If there's a disagreement, they use fraud proofs to sort things out.
- Zero-Knowledge (ZK) Rollups: Here, they employ some cool cryptographic techniques (like SNARKs and STARKs) to validate state changes on the spot.
Key Features:
- You get a shared security model that works seamlessly with the main chain.
- Enjoy high throughput while keeping on-chain data to a minimum.
- Say goodbye to high gas fees and hello to better scalability!
Use Cases:
- DeFi apps that need top-notch security and quick transactions
- NFT marketplaces that handle a lot of traffic
Cost Analysis
Cost of Sidechains
Transaction Fees:
- Usually cheaper than the mainnet, but they can change depending on the validator set and security model.
- You’ll be paying fees to the validators on the sidechain, not the main chain.
Operational Costs:
- Keeping the validator infrastructure running smoothly
- Ensuring bridge security through regular audits and upgrades
- For instance, Polygon (previously known as Matic) typically charges around 0.01-0.05 USD per transaction, which is a lot more wallet-friendly compared to the Ethereum mainnet that can range from ~0.1 to 1 USD.
Cost Considerations:
- There's a greater chance of security breaches, which could mean losing valuable assets.
- You might also face extra costs for managing infrastructure like bridges and validators.
Cost of Rollups
Transaction Fees:
- There's been a big drop in fees thanks to off-chain execution.
- With Zero-Knowledge Rollups, you could save as much as 90% compared to using the mainnet!
Operator Costs:
- Costs associated with the infrastructure needed to generate validity proofs (like SNARKs and STARKs)
- Expenses for data availability and compression
- For instance, both zkSync and Arbitrum have shared that they’re seeing gas fees drop by about 70-90%!
Cost Considerations:
- There are some potential trade-offs to think about when it comes to proof generation costs versus transaction throughput.
- If you're dealing with applications that have a ton of transactions, rollups can really help by providing some solid scalable cost efficiency.
Security Trade-offs
Security in Sidechains
Model:
- Security relies heavily on the validator set and the consensus mechanism.
- It's not as secure as the main chain, so if the validator set is small or not well managed, it can be at risk of 51% attacks.
Risks:
- Possible collusion or compromise of validators
- Vulnerabilities in bridges that could result in asset theft (like the Horizon attack on Harmony)
Best Practices:
- Go for decentralized validator sets that are thoroughly audited
- Set up strong security protocols for bridges
- Don’t skimp on regular security audits and formal verification
Security in Rollups
Model:
- Enjoy main chain security alongside Ethereum (or any other base layer)
- Zero-Knowledge Rollups: backed by cryptographic proof of correctness
- Optimistic Rollups: depend on fraud proofs and have built-in challenge periods
Risks:
- Potential delays in fraud proof processes with optimistic rollups
- Vulnerability to data availability attacks if the data isn't posted properly
- Reliance on the base chain's security for overall safety
Best Practices:
- Go for zkRollups if you're working with applications that need top-notch security.
- Stick to optimistic rollups for applications that can handle some challenge periods.
- Keep your cryptographic protocols and validation logic up to date regularly.
User Experience (UX) Considerations
UX in Sidechains
Pros:
- Quicker transaction finality on the sidechain
- Flexible interfaces (like privacy options and custom tokens)
Cons:
- You’ve got to juggle multiple wallets and bridges.
- Moving assets across chains can get tricky and take time (hello, bridge waiting games).
- There are some security worries when it comes to bridge exploits.
Practical Tips:
- Make sure to include seamless bridging in your dApps
- Consider using custodial solutions to enhance user experience
- Offer real-time updates on the status of cross-chain transactions
UX in Rollups
Pros:
- Get your transactions confirmed almost instantly.
- Enjoy a single wallet interface that plays nice with main chains like Ethereum.
- Onboarding is a breeze since users only deal with Layer 2.
Cons:
- There can be a bit of a delay in finality, especially with optimistic rollups.
- You're restricted to the applications and rollup implementations that are supported.
Practical Tips:
- Make sure users get instant feedback on their transaction status.
- Take advantage of existing wallet integrations like MetaMask and WalletConnect.
- Be upfront about finality and dispute periods so users know what to expect.
Sidechains in Action
Polygon (Matic):
- Merges PoS sidechain security with easy Ethereum bridging
- Works with popular DeFi protocols like Aave and Curve
- Cost: about 0.01 USD per transaction; super high throughput at around 7,000 TPS
Use Case:
- Gaming dApps that need super-fast asset transfers
- Privacy-centered transactions using custom sidechains
Rollups in Action
zkSync (ZK Rollup):
- Lets you send ETH and ERC-20 tokens with about 90% gas savings--pretty cool, right?
- Transfers get instant finality, so you don’t have to wait around.
- It’s already being used by decentralized exchanges such as ZigZag.
Arbitrum (Optimistic Rollup):
- Works seamlessly with current Ethereum smart contracts
- Provides scalable options for DeFi and NFT platforms
- Includes a 7-day challenge period for resolving disputes
Best Practices and Recommendations
- For Cost-Sensitive, High-Throughput Apps: Go for rollups, and if you can, zkRollups--they're all about maximizing security and efficiency.
- For Custom Features or Privacy Needs: Think about using sidechains with their own unique consensus mechanisms, but make sure you have top-notch security for those bridges.
- Hybrid Approaches: Mix it up! Use sidechains for certain features while keeping rollups for your core DeFi functions.
- Security Audits: Always do a deep dive with thorough audits of your bridges and validator sets, no matter what technology you're rolling with.
- User Experience: Keep user experience in mind! Aim for smooth bridging, clear transaction updates, and keep things simple to encourage more people to jump on board.
Conclusion
When deciding between sidechains and rollups, it really comes down to what your app needs in terms of security, budget, and user experience:
- Sidechains are great for flexibility and keeping costs down, but they do come with some security trade-offs. They work best for private, non-critical applications.
- Rollups offer top-notch security that matches mainnet standards while also slashing costs. They’re perfect for DeFi projects, NFT platforms, and enterprise-level solutions.
Strategic Implementation Tip: A lot of top projects are getting on board with hybrid models these days. They’re using rollups for their main assets while opting for sidechains when it comes to specialized features or keeping things private. This approach helps them get the best of both worlds while keeping risks in check.
Final Thoughts
As blockchain scalability keeps growing, it’s super important to stay in the loop about new developments in cryptography, bridge security, and design that puts users first. 7Block Labs suggests taking a phased approach--think testing, auditing, and slowly rolling things out--tailored to fit your company or startup’s risk tolerance and performance targets.
Description:
This is your go-to guide for diving deep into the differences between sidechains and rollups. We’ll break down their cost structures, security models, and how they impact user experience--everything you need to help you choose the right blockchain scalability solution for your project.
Like what you're reading? Let's build together.
Get a free 30-minute consultation with our engineering team.
Related Posts
ByAUJay
Building Supply Chain Trackers for Luxury Goods: A Step-by-Step Guide
How to Create Supply Chain Trackers for Luxury Goods
ByAUJay
Building 'Private Social Networks' with Onchain Keys
Creating Private Social Networks with Onchain Keys
ByAUJay
Tokenizing Intellectual Property for AI Models: A Simple Guide
## How to Tokenize “Intellectual Property” for AI Models ### Summary: A lot of AI teams struggle to show what their models have been trained on or what licenses they comply with. With the EU AI Act set to kick in by 2026 and new publisher standards like RSL 1.0 making things more transparent, it's becoming more crucial than ever to get this right.

